1. Eliminating Credential Fraud and Unauthorized Gain Access To
Among the most persistent difficulties in event monitoring is the misuse of access qualifications. Traditional techniques like wristbands or paper badges are quickly shared, shed, or duplicated.

Anti-Passback Surveillance: Alertoo's AI can track details individuals as they move through a location. If a solitary credential is used twice in a manner that recommends "passback" actions (e.g., passing a badge through a fence to an unauthorized person), the system can activate an prompt alert for safety and security treatment.

Biometric Confirmation: By incorporating with face recognition and biometric entry systems, Alertoo guarantees that the individual getting in the "VIP" or "Backstage" zone is the real owner of the credential. This properly gets rid of the secondary market for taken or shared event badges.

Tailgating Discovery: A common fraud tactic is "tailgating"-- adhering to a genuine attendee very closely via a turnstile or protected gateway. Alertoo's vision versions recognize these dual-entry efforts in real-time, avoiding unauthorized people from bypassing paid entry points.

2. Avoiding "Inside Job" Fraud and Operational Burglary
Fraud at large events is commonly an internal problem. High-turnover momentary staff and complicated supplier ecological communities can develop opportunities for operational burglary and financial leakage.

Point-of-Sale (POS) Stability: By aligning video feeds with deal information, Alertoo can find dubious patterns at snack bar and product booths. For instance, if a "No Sale" or " Space" transaction is recorded while the AI sees a physical exchange of items, the event is flagged for prospective "sweethearting" or employee theft.

Supply and Packing Dock Safety and security: High-value devices and product are most vulnerable during the "load-in" and "load-out" phases. Alertoo keeps an eye on filling areas to ensure that every vehicle and combination leaving the site is accredited, preventing the fraud protection for events illegal elimination of properties under the cover of event disorder.

Restricted Area Enforcement: Deceitful task frequently takes place in non-public locations like cash money counting rooms or equipment storage. Alertoo's "Virtual Tripwire" technology ensures that just confirmed workers go into these high-risk zones, logging every entry and leave with aesthetic evidence.

3. Group Analytics for Ticket Tier Stability
In venues with multi-tiered pricing-- such as stadium concerts with "Golden Circle" or "GA" areas-- guests often try to fraudulently move to higher-value zones without paying.

Area Occupancy and Flow Monitoring: Alertoo keeps an eye on the thickness and movement of crowds between sections. If the AI identifies an unusual surge of individuals moving from a low-tier section into a high-value zone via a fire exit or unguarded obstacle, security groups are informed right away.

Behavioral Abnormality Detection: Specialist scammers typically pass time near leaves or staff-only hallways to find weak points in the venue's border. Alertoo identifies these loitering patterns, permitting safety and security to engage potential fraudsters before they can help with a larger violation.

4. The Power of Complex Event Logic
What sets Alertoo apart in fraud protection for events is the ability to produce Complicated Event Logic. This permits organizers to specify details fraud situations by integrating numerous AI activates.

Instance Situation: Trigger an sharp IF a individual enters a restricted "Backstage" area ( Invasion Discovery) AND the individual is NOT using a " Team" high-visibility vest (PPE Discovery) AND they are bring an unacknowledged item (Object Detection).

This multi-layered strategy guarantees that security sources are routed towards high-probability fraud efforts instead of regular movement, taking full advantage of the effectiveness of the security team.
